This is the legal agreement between you and Exafunction, Inc. (the company behind Windsurf) that controls how you can use their AI coding tools. The most important thing to know is that by default, everything you type into the Chat feature — including your code and prompts — is used to train Windsurf's AI models, and opting out means you permanently lose access to the Chat service. If you pay for a subscription, it auto-renews and all fees are non-refundable, so you must cancel before your renewal date to avoid being charged.
Technical Summary
This document constitutes the Terms of Service for Exafunction, Inc.'s Windsurf/Cognition platform (Individual & Pro tiers), governing access to an AI-powered coding assistant through a clickwrap agreement that incorporates the company's Privacy Policy by reference. The most significant obligations include: users grant Exafunction a broad, perpetual, irrevocable, royalty-free license to exploit user Feedback; user Chat Content is used by default to train generative and discriminative ML models (opt-out disables Chat Services entirely); and all subscription fees are non-refundable with automatic renewal unless cancelled before the renewal date. Notable deviations from industry standard include the coercive opt-out mechanism for Chat data — where exercising the privacy right results in loss of core service functionality — and the deletion of user accounts and associated data without liability when payment methods lapse. The document engages CCPA (California Consumer Privacy Act), COPPA (minimum age 13), DMCA (17 U.S.C. § 512), and general FTC Act Section 5 unfair/deceptive practices frameworks; the mandatory binding arbitration clause with class action waiver (Section 20) is the primary litigation-risk provision requiring compliance team attention, particularly for enterprise procurement and B2B contracting contexts.
If you have a dispute with Windsurf, you cannot sue them in court or join a class action lawsuit — you must resolve it through private arbitration on your own, one-on-one.
Windsurf uses everything you type into the Chat feature — your code, questions, and prompts — to train its AI models. If you want to stop this, you lose access to the Chat feature entirely.
Your Windsurf subscription renews automatically and charges you for the next full period if you don't cancel before the renewal date — and once charged, fees are not refunded.
If your credit card expires or is declined when your subscription renews, Windsurf can permanently delete your account and all your data with no obligation to notify you or compensate you.
If you ever suggest improvements or report issues to Windsurf, they own those ideas forever and can use them for any purpose — for free, with no credit to you.
Code you write using Windsurf's autocomplete feature is used to train Windsurf's AI ranking models, but you can opt out in settings without losing the autocomplete feature — unlike Chat.
If you pay for a Pro subscription, you can enable a Zero Data Retention mode where your code is processed in real-time, deleted immediately after a response is generated, and never stored or used for training.
Windsurf collects data about how you use the platform — not your code itself, but behavioral and performance data — and owns it outright, including any new products or insights derived from it.
Windsurf can monitor, record, and copy anything you transmit through their service at any time, but claims no responsibility for the content they monitor.
Windsurf requires users to be at least 13 years old, but relies on users' own representations rather than age verification — meaning there is no technical barrier to younger children accessing the service.
